At a Glance

Both DocuSign API and SignRequest offer comprehensive solutions for integrating e-signature capabilities into applications, but they cater to different needs and business sizes. Below is a side-by-side comparison to help you quickly discern their key features and offerings.

Feature DocuSign API SignRequest
Founded 2003 2014
Target Users Enterprises, legal and compliance-driven processes Small to medium businesses
Free Tier Developer Sandbox (non-production) Free (10 documents per month)
Compliance Standards SOC 2 Type II, GDPR, eIDAS, HIPAA, 21 CFR Part 11 SOC 2 Type II, GDPR, eIDAS, HIPAA
Primary Products eSignature API, Rooms API, CLM API, Monitor API e-signature platform, document workflow automation, API for e-signatures
Available SDKs C#, Java, Node.js, PHP, Python, Ruby None specified
Pricing Starting Point $50/month for 50 envelopes $7 per user/month, billed annually

In terms of developer support, DocuSign provides extensive SDKs and documentation across multiple programming languages such as C#, Java, and Python, facilitating a broad range of integration scenarios. This is especially beneficial for enterprises that require complex, customized solutions. In contrast, SignRequest offers a RESTful API that is well-documented and supports integration in several languages, making it accessible for smaller development teams or businesses seeking a straightforward implementation.

Compliance and security are critical in the e-signature space. Both platforms adhere to major standards like SOC 2 Type II and GDPR. However, DocuSign extends its compliance to include 21 CFR Part 11, which can be crucial for industries like pharmaceuticals or healthcare, as noted in AWS compliance resources.

In conclusion, the choice between DocuSign API and SignRequest largely depends on the size and specific needs of the business. DocuSign is tailored for enterprises needing extensive customization and integration, while SignRequest suits smaller businesses looking for a cost-effective, easy-to-implement solution.

Pricing Comparison

When evaluating DocuSign API and SignRequest for e-signature solutions, pricing is a critical factor for organizations of all sizes. Both platforms offer distinct cost structures that cater to different business needs and scales.

Feature DocuSign API SignRequest
Free Tier DocuSign provides a Developer Sandbox, which is a non-production environment allowing developers to test and build integrations without any cost. However, it does not include any free allocation of envelopes for production use. SignRequest offers a free tier that allows users to send up to 10 documents per month. This can be particularly appealing for small businesses or individuals who do not require a high volume of document processing.
Starting Paid Tier The starting paid tier for DocuSign API is the "API Individual" plan, priced at $50 per month, which includes 50 envelopes. This tier is suited for small businesses or individual developers who need a moderate number of transactions. SignRequest's "Professional" plan starts at $7 per user per month, billed annually. This plan is designed for small to medium businesses and provides essential e-signature functionalities at a lower entry cost compared to DocuSign.
Enterprise Options DocuSign offers custom enterprise pricing, which includes advanced features and higher envelope volumes, making it ideal for large organizations with extensive document management needs. More details can be explored on their pricing page. SignRequest also offers custom enterprise pricing, allowing businesses to tailor the service to their specific requirements. This flexibility can be beneficial for companies looking to scale their operations. Further information is available on the SignRequest pricing page.

Considering the pricing structures, organizations must assess their document volume and specific feature needs. DocuSign's higher entry cost might be justified by its extensive feature set and integration capabilities, particularly for enterprises. In contrast, SignRequest's lower starting cost and free tier can be a significant advantage for smaller businesses or those just beginning to incorporate digital signatures into their workflow. For further insights into how each platform might fit your business needs, examining their API documentation could provide more clarity.

Developer Experience

Both DocuSign API and SignRequest offer valuable resources for developers, but their approaches to developer experience differ significantly. This section examines their onboarding processes, documentation quality, and the availability of SDKs.

Aspect DocuSign API SignRequest
Onboarding DocuSign provides a comprehensive Developer Sandbox that allows users to test and develop applications before committing to a paid plan. This sandbox environment is designed to facilitate experimentation with the API's capabilities without financial risk. SignRequest offers a free tier that includes up to 10 documents per month, which can be utilized during the initial development phase. This setup is particularly beneficial for small teams or individual developers looking to explore the API's features with minimal cost.
Documentation Quality DocuSign's documentation is known for its detail and clarity, covering a wide array of common tasks such as sending and signing documents. The availability of numerous examples across various languages aids developers in understanding and implementing the API effectively. The SignRequest documentation is concise and well-structured, offering clear guidance on API integration. Although it lacks dedicated SDKs, the documentation provides sample codes in popular languages, simplifying the process of embedding e-signature functionality into applications.
SDK Availability DocuSign offers SDKs for a variety of programming languages, including C#, Java, Node.js, PHP, Python, and Ruby. This wide range of SDKs allows developers to integrate DocuSign's services into their applications seamlessly, leveraging language-specific features and optimizations. Unlike DocuSign, SignRequest does not provide official SDKs. However, the API's RESTful nature and well-documented endpoints make it straightforward for developers to implement using their preferred programming languages without the need for SDKs.

In summary, DocuSign's advantage lies in its extensive SDK support and detailed documentation, which are suitable for large enterprises and developers who require comprehensive resources. SignRequest, on the other hand, offers a simpler and more cost-effective solution for smaller businesses and developers seeking to integrate basic e-signature capabilities quickly.

Verdict

When deciding between the DocuSign API and SignRequest, it is essential to consider specific business needs and operational contexts. Both offer valuable e-signature solutions, but they cater to different organizational scales and priorities.

DocuSign API is notably powerful for enterprises requiring extensive document management capabilities and integration options. It is well-suited for organizations with complex legal and compliance-driven processes, as it supports standards such as SOC 2 Type II, GDPR, eIDAS, HIPAA, and 21 CFR Part 11. Its offerings, like the eSignature API and extensive SDK support for languages such as C#, Java, and Python, make it an ideal choice for businesses looking to automate intricate document workflows at scale, particularly when embedding signature functionalities within existing applications is crucial.

Conversely, SignRequest is often a better match for small to medium-sized businesses, emphasizing simplicity and cost-effectiveness. With a clear focus on straightforward integration, SignRequest provides an accessible API for e-signatures without the need for SDKs. It is appropriate for businesses prioritizing secure document signing without the necessity of comprehensive document management features. The platform's pricing, starting at just $7 per user/month, along with a free tier that allows up to 10 documents per month, offers a compelling option for budget-conscious entities.

Criteria DocuSign API SignRequest
Target Business Size Large enterprises Small to medium businesses
Pricing From $50/month for 50 envelopes From $7/user/month, free tier available
Compliance SOC 2 Type II, GDPR, eIDAS, HIPAA, 21 CFR Part 11 SOC 2 Type II, GDPR, eIDAS, HIPAA
SDK Availability Yes, multiple languages No, API-driven
Core Use Comprehensive document workflows Simple e-signatures

Ultimately, choose DocuSign if your organization demands extensive documentation features, legal compliance, and flexible integrations with existing enterprise systems, potentially useful for sectors like finance or healthcare. On the other hand, go with SignRequest if you aim for a straightforward, budget-friendly solution that efficiently addresses basic e-signature needs, making it apt for startups or small businesses.

Use Cases

When evaluating the use cases for DocuSign API and SignRequest, it's important to consider the specific needs and industries each service is best suited for. Both platforms offer e-signature solutions, but they cater to different segments and use case scenarios.

DocuSign API is particularly well-suited for enterprise environments and industries where document management and compliance are paramount. With its comprehensive set of APIs, including the eSignature API, Rooms API, CLM API, and Monitor API, DocuSign is ideal for automating complex document workflows. This makes it a popular choice in sectors such as finance, healthcare, and legal services, where adherence to regulations like HIPAA and 21 CFR Part 11 is crucial. Additionally, DocuSign's extensive compliance credentials, including SOC 2 Type II and GDPR, further bolster its suitability for legally sensitive processes.

On the other hand, SignRequest is tailored more towards small to medium-sized businesses seeking a straightforward and cost-effective e-signature solution. It is particularly beneficial for industries that require secure document signing without the need for extensive document management capabilities. SignRequest's simple API enables businesses to integrate e-signature functionality into their applications with ease, making it a good fit for use cases in real estate, small business operations, and startups. Its free tier, allowing for up to 10 documents per month, is attractive to those who are budget-conscious or have relatively low-volume signing needs.

DocuSign API SignRequest
Best for enterprise-grade document management and compliance-driven processes. Ideal for small to medium businesses and simple e-signature integrations.
Strong in industries like finance, healthcare, and legal services. Suited for real estate, startups, and general business operations.
Offers multiple APIs for various document-related tasks. Focuses primarily on e-signature functionality.

Both DocuSign API and SignRequest provide valuable e-signature solutions, each excelling in different environments. While DocuSign is more appropriate for large-scale enterprises with complex needs, SignRequest offers a user-friendly, affordable solution for smaller businesses and straightforward e-signature requirements. For further insights into these platforms, you may refer to the DocuSign API documentation and SignRequest API documentation.

Security and Compliance

Security and compliance are critical considerations when selecting an e-signature API, and both DocuSign API and SignRequest offer features that address these needs. However, there are differences in the range and depth of their compliance capabilities.

DocuSign API SignRequest

DocuSign API is designed to meet stringent compliance standards, making it suitable for use in heavily regulated industries. The API adheres to SOC 2 Type II, GDPR, eIDAS, HIPAA, and 21 CFR Part 11 requirements. These certifications ensure that DocuSign can handle sensitive data securely and comply with various international and industry-specific regulations. The inclusion of 21 CFR Part 11 is particularly relevant for businesses in the pharmaceutical and life sciences sectors, where electronic records must meet specific FDA requirements.

SignRequest, while also compliant with several key standards, offers a slightly narrower scope in its compliance suite. It supports SOC 2 Type II, GDPR, eIDAS, and HIPAA, ensuring that it meets the necessary privacy and security mandates for handling personal and health information across different regions. The absence of 21 CFR Part 11, however, may limit its use in certain regulated environments compared to DocuSign.

Both APIs utilize encryption to protect data during transmission and storage. DocuSign employs advanced encryption technologies, ensuring that documents and signatures are securely handled. According to Microsoft's compliance guide on DocuSign, the API also includes audit trails and is capable of providing detailed logs of document interactions to maintain transparency and accountability.

SignRequest also emphasizes security with its encrypted platform, facilitating secure document handling and user authentication. As stated on their security page, SignRequest employs measures to ensure data integrity and user privacy. The platform's focus on straightforward compliance makes it an appealing option for small to medium businesses that do not require the extensive regulatory coverage that DocuSign provides.

Ultimately, the choice between DocuSign API and SignRequest may hinge on specific compliance requirements and the regulatory environment in which a business operates. While DocuSign offers a broader range of certifications suitable for large enterprises and regulated industries, SignRequest caters effectively to smaller organizations with essential compliance needs.

Ecosystem and Integrations

When considering the ecosystem and integration capabilities of DocuSign API and SignRequest, both offer pathways to enhance productivity through e-signature functionality, but they cater to different needs and scales of integration.

DocuSign API presents a more expansive ecosystem, particularly suitable for enterprises looking to integrate e-signatures into complex workflows. It supports a wide array of SDKs, including C#, Java, Node.js, PHP, Python, and Ruby, facilitating integration into diverse application environments. This versatility is further enhanced by comprehensive API documentation, which assists developers in embedding e-signature capabilities efficiently. DocuSign's ecosystem is bolstered by its integration with key enterprise platforms such as Salesforce and Microsoft, allowing for seamless incorporation into existing business processes. Additionally, it supports advanced document management and compliance features, making it ideal for industries with stringent regulatory requirements.

On the other hand, SignRequest targets small to medium-sized businesses with straightforward integration needs. Although it does not provide specific SDKs, the API documentation is well-structured, providing clear guidance for integrating e-signature functions into applications. SignRequest supports integration through standard RESTful API methods, which are compatible with popular programming languages such as Python, PHP, Node.js, Ruby, C#, and Java. While SignRequest's ecosystem might not be as extensive as DocuSign's, its acquisition by Box suggests potential for deeper integrations and enhancements in the future. Its pricing model and free tier make it accessible for smaller teams or startups looking to implement e-signatures without extensive overhead.

Feature DocuSign API SignRequest
SDK Support Available for C#, Java, Node.js, PHP, Python, Ruby No specific SDKs, RESTful API
Integration Platforms Salesforce, Microsoft Potential through Box
Primary Audience Enterprises SMBs

In summary, while DocuSign offers a more comprehensive integration ecosystem suited for large-scale and compliance-heavy environments, SignRequest provides a simpler, cost-effective solution for smaller businesses. Both have their strengths, with DocuSign excelling in enterprise integrations and SignRequest offering ease of use and accessibility for smaller teams.